Hanoi, and the last stop (bangkok doesn't count!) on our trip. We loved Hanoi, so much better than Saigon in our opinion. We never bored of wandering around the Old Quarter and just watching what was going on. Some great shops, cafes and the odd temple/pagoda that you just kind of stumble across.
